Output 599961ddd14cc77387d81249b036a920fda646733f30cc647ad568e5c6b33613:0

value
121605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c0e1a179014354a3842e1cdee2c4f27d6b33e4f OP_EQUAL
address
MLfhj7436NFLALAZAxsyHFNYCtpjqjFa95
transaction
599961ddd14cc77387d81249b036a920fda646733f30cc647ad568e5c6b33613
spent
true